Position Summary

Responsible for collecting, tracking, and reconciling patient medical record information obtained from departments or nursing units once the patient is discharged.

Serves as an information resource by responding to requests for general and medical record information received via phone, e-mail, fax, or in person. Retrieves records per request for patient care, studies, committees, and other requests, and works with other departments as needed.

Essential Functions and Responsibilities
  • Collects, tracks, and reconciles patient medical record information obtained from departments or nursing units once the patient is discharged.
  • Prepares, scans, quality checks, and validates records for document storage and/or imaging, utilizing facility guidelines.
  • Assists with physician chart completion and suspension processes, including assigning and validating chart deficiencies, communicating with providers regarding incomplete records, and assisting with distribution of reports, letters, and statistics related to delinquent medical records.
  • Escalates documentation holds to clinical and administrative personnel.
  • Tracks tasks and time spent, meeting or exceeding quality and production targets.
  • Performs standardized chart audits following established guidelines and procedures.
  • Accesses the Electronic Medical Records (EMR) system to support record completion, coding, release of information, and management of the legal health record.
  • Performs EMPI tasks according to policies, procedures, and timeframes.
  • Assists with patient portal enrollment.
  • Performs medical transcription tasks according to policies, procedures, and timeframes.
Qualifications

Required:

  • High School diploma
  • Two years of HIM experience.

Preferred:

  • RHIT Certified or eligible
  • CRCR Certified
  • Associate’s degree in HIM or related healthcare field.
